The Blower Replacement Project involves replacing three existing air blowers and modifying the air distribution system. The scope includes replacing air headers with single designated aeration headers to aeration basins and channels. Aeration basin downcomers, air grids, and associated instrumentation and controls will also be replaced. Equipment for this project will be furnished externally. The blowers and aeration system will integrate with the facility’s electrical and instrumentation systems and other utilities.The project includes installation of three new externally furnished blowers: two units with 27,000 SCFM capacity and one unit with 35,000 SCFM capacity, used for aeration distribution systems. Additional work includes installation of a motor control center, aeration headers to nine aeration basins and one header to channels, instrumentation such as flow meters, dissolved oxygen meters, control valves, and integration of new aeration grids with the existing air distribution systems. Tie-ins with the existing foul air intake chamber and all associated piping, electrical, and instrumentation are included as outlined in the contract documents.The electrical system upgrade includes replacing three existing 4160 V synchronous motor starters with new 4160 V motor soft starters equipped with power factor correction capacitors. The upgrade also involves replacing existing 480 V motor control centers (MCCs) and associated wiring with new MCCs and wiring. The scope of work includes demolition of three blowers and much of the aeration system, installation of externally provided replacements, integration with existing equipment, utilities, and control systems, and reconstruction of affected parts of the facility.
